Looking for a fresh twist on Thanksgiving flavors? These crispy, sticky turkey wings are a fun and flavorful alternative to traditional roasted turkey. Seasoned with sumac, cumin, and garlic, the wings are baked to golden perfection, then coated in a sweet-tart cranberry and pomegranate sauce with a hint of orange zest. The result is a sticky, crispy delight that pairs classic holiday ingredients with a Middle Eastern-inspired flavor profile. Ingredients
- 6 turkey wings
- 1 ½ teaspoons salt
- ¼ teaspoon pepper
- 1 tablespoon Jamie Geller Sumac
- 1 tablespoon garlic powder
- ½ tablespoon cumin
- 1 tablespoon baking powder
Sauce
- 1 cup whole dried cranberries frozen will work too
- ¾ cup pomegranate juice
- ¼ cup brown sugar
- ¼ teaspoon orange zest
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 1 cup water
Garnish
- Pomegranate arils
- Parsley leaves

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350℉.
- Pat and dry wings with a paper towel.
- In a small bowl mix salt, pepper, sumac, garlic powder, cumin and baking powder. Rub the turkey wings with spice mix until coated all over.
- Place spiced wings on a sheet pan and roast for about 1 hour, flipping as needed, until crispy and golden.
- In a saucepan add cranberries, pomegranate juice, brown sugar, orange zest, salt, and water. Bring to a simmer and cook until cranberries soften. Once soft, blend with an immersion blender.
- Coat the wings in the sauce then return to the oven for 5-10 minutes. Garnish with parsley and pomegranate and enjoy.
